HEALTHCARE INFORMATION AND LITERATURE SEARCHING

  • Learn to search for journal article abstracts or citations using quality healthcare databases, including Medline, BNI (British Nursing Index), CINAHL, PsycINFO, or HMIC (Health Management Information Consortium) 

  • Learn how to access over 2,000 full-text journals 

  • Good for evidence-based practice, research, audit, or guideline writing 

  • Databases for all disciplines including medical, nursing, psychology and the therapies 

  • Requires some internet experience 

Duration: 60 minutes.
